Introduction to Heavy Commercial Vehicle Real-Time Parking System Market
Real-time parking systems for heavy commercial vehicles streamline the parking process, enhance efficiency, and improve driver safety. The market’s growth is driven by the increasing demand for efficient logistics and transportation solutions.
Key Market Trends and Drivers
- Urbanization and Last-Mile Delivery: The rise of urban centers and the demand for last-mile delivery solutions necessitate efficient parking for heavy commercial vehicles.
- Driver Safety: Real-time parking systems enhance driver safety by providing information on available parking spaces and navigation assistance.
- Efficiency and Cost Savings: These systems optimize parking, reducing fuel consumption and operational costs for fleet operators.
- Technological Advancements: Innovations in sensor technology and connectivity contribute to improved real-time parking solutions.
- Sustainability Focus: Real-time parking systems help reduce traffic congestion and emissions in urban areas.

North America Takes the Lead in Real-Time Parking Systems
North America currently holds the largest share in the heavy commercial vehicle real-time parking system market, driven by extensive urbanization, logistics demands, and a focus on driver safety. The region’s leadership is further reinforced by advanced technology adoption.
Europe Follows with Efficiency Focus
Europe is the second-largest market for heavy commercial vehicle real-time parking systems, benefitting from its efficient transportation networks and a commitment to sustainability. The region’s emphasis on efficient logistics contributes to market growth.
Asia-Pacific Emerges as a High-Growth Region
The Asia-Pacific region is experiencing rapid market growth, attributed to the expansion of e-commerce, urbanization, and the need for last-mile delivery solutions. The region presents significant opportunities for market expansion, driven by the growing adoption of real-time parking systems.
Latin America and Middle East & Africa Show Promise
Latin America and the Middle East & Africa regions are emerging as promising markets for heavy commercial vehicle real-time parking systems. The growth of urban centers, logistics infrastructure development, and the focus on driver safety drive the need for efficient parking solutions.
